Negotiation Tactics
Request Educational Pricing
AnyDesk offers special pricing for schools and educational institutions, though specific discount amounts are not publicly advertised. Contact sales@anydesk.com directly before purchasing a standard license to ask about education pricing. Mention your institution type and number of devices upfront.

Use Competitor Quotes as Leverage at Renewal
AnyDesk faces direct price competition from Splashtop, ConnectWise Control, and RustDesk—all of which multiple users cite as cheaper or comparable alternatives. Get current quotes from at least one competitor before renewal discussions and present them to your AnyDesk rep. Users have switched away over pricing, so churn risk gives you leverage.

Get Multi-Year Pricing In Writing
AnyDesk has historically offered multi-year license discounts. However, at least one user reported AnyDesk attempting to not honor a 2-year pricing agreement at the second-year renewal. If negotiating multi-year terms, ensure the agreed price is explicitly documented in the contract or order confirmation before paying.

Choose Annual Billing for Automatic 20% Savings
Switching from monthly to annual billing saves approximately 20% with no negotiation required. Standard plan drops from $49.90/month to $39.92/month. Advanced plan drops from $111.90/month to $89.52/month. For a Standard plan user, this saves roughly $119/year automatically.

Contact Sales for Custom or Volume Pricing
AnyDesk's official support representatives consistently direct businesses with specific or larger-scale needs to contact sales@anydesk.com. For teams needing the Ultimate plan or volume licensing for many devices, custom pricing is available that is not listed on the public pricing page.

Frequently Asked Questions
01 Is AnyDesk pricing negotiable?
Yes, AnyDesk pricing is highly negotiable, especially for deals over 10 users or $10,000 annually. Most companies that negotiate save 15-30% off list price.
02 When is the best time to negotiate with AnyDesk?
End of quarter (March, June, September, December) and especially end of fiscal year. Sales reps are motivated to hit quotas and more willing to offer discounts to close deals.
03 What discounts can I expect from AnyDesk?
Typical discounts range from 10-30% depending on deal size, commitment length, and timing. Multi-year commitments typically get 15-25% off. Larger deployments (50+ users) often get 20-30% off.
04 Should I use a procurement team or negotiate directly?
For deals over $50K annually, consider involving procurement or a buying group. They have experience negotiating software contracts and may get better terms. For smaller deals, negotiating directly works well.
05 What if AnyDesk says the price is non-negotiable?
This is often a starting position. Ask to speak with a manager, mention you're evaluating competitors, or wait until quarter-end. If truly non-negotiable, negotiate on other terms like payment terms, support, or contract length.
